Empoleon Makes Waves as the Latest Melee All-Rounder in Pokémon UNITE

Empoleon Joins the Battle in Pokémon UNITE
Pokémon UNITE has introduced a new contender: Empoleon, the Emperor Pokémon. This addition brings a formidable Water- and Steel-type character to the vibrant battles on Aeos Island. Players will begin their journey as Piplup, evolve into Prinplup, and ultimately transform into Empoleon, gaining access to more powerful moves and abilities at each stage of evolution.
A Closer Look at Empoleon's Abilities
Empoleon is categorized as a Melee All-Rounder, combining speed with durability in combat. Its unique ability,Torrent,charges up a special gauge as it inflicts damage or over time. Onc this gauge reaches a specific level, Empoleon’s attacks become even more potent. Notably, when its health dips below a certain threshold, the gauge fills up quicker—allowing for increased power during critical moments.
Starting Moves: Piplup's Early Game
At the begining of matches as Piplup, players can utilize moves like Peck and Water Gun. These abilities can be enhanced by Torrent to add effects such as slowing down opponents or increasing damage output. Upon reaching level 5 in-game progression, players must choose between two exciting options: Metal Claw—which provides shielding when boosted—or Aqua Jet that increases attack speed while reducing enemy special Defense when empowered.

Advanced Moves: Leveling Up with Hydro Cannon and Whirlpool
As players advance to level 7 with Empoleon unlocked, thay gain access to powerful moves like Hydro Cannon—a ranged water blast that stuns foes while creating an area of effect whirlpool upon boosting—or Whirlpool itself—a close-range attack that damages enemies while providing healing benefits and pushing them back. Both skills can be upgraded further for improved cooldowns or enhanced healing capabilities.
The Ultimate Move: Sovereign Slide
Empoleon’s Unite Move is called Sovereign Slide; it allows this Pokémon to dash forward rapidly while generating a whirlpool on impact that damages enemies caught within its grasp—also throwing them off balance and slowing their movements down substantially. While this whirlpool remains active on the battlefield, Empoleon accumulates Torrent energy at an accelerated rate—enabling trainers to unleash multiple boosted moves during intense skirmishes.
